Ribosome synthesis in Rhodopseudomonas capsulata cells growing in continuous and intermittent light.

G A Din, H Gest.   

Abstract

The ribosome content was markedly reduced when illumination (at 28 C) was repeatedly interrupted; an opposite trend was observed with continuous light as the temperature was decreased.
